Walking into BPCM's showroom is one of the more overwhelming experiences of doing market. So much to see, so little time. Where to begin? For now, Cushnie et Ochs. The Fall line had so much I loved, I shot nearly the entire thing to share with you. But really, what's the point of that? So after much editing, I came up with the three pieces I would buy.
I'm a pencil skirt junkie. Chock it up to having curves, but pencils are the most flattering silhouette out there. Cushnie had two that I need. The first, a black jersey one with pleated sides ($950), is simple and yet not. For Cushnie it's as basic as it gets, but the detailing is fun. The other skirt that made me stop mid-rack was the flaked leather one ($1,695). That's not fur—it's leather. And it's incredible.
